#include <kapi/devices.hpp>

#include <kernel/devices/root_bus.hpp>

#include <kapi/system.hpp>
#include <kapi/test_support/devices.hpp>

#include <kstd/flat_map.hpp>
#include <kstd/memory.hpp>
#include <kstd/print.hpp>
#include <kstd/string.hpp>

#include <optional>
#include <string_view>
#include <utility>

namespace kapi::devices
{
  namespace
  {
    auto constinit root_bus = std::optional<kernel::devices::root_bus>{};
    auto constinit device_tree = kstd::flat_map<kstd::string, kstd::observer_ptr<device>>{};
  }  // namespace

  auto init() -> void
  {
    if (root_bus.has_value())
    {
      kapi::system::panic("[OS:DEV] The device subsystem has already been initialized");
    }

    interface_registry::init();

    auto & bus = root_bus.emplace();
    register_device(bus);
    bus.init();
  }

  auto get_root_bus() -> bus &
  {
    if (!root_bus.has_value())
    {
      kapi::system::panic("[OS:DEV] Root bus not initialized!");
    }
    return *root_bus;
  }

  auto register_device(device & device) -> bool
  {
    kstd::println("[OS:DEV] Registering device {}", device.name());
    return device_tree.emplace(device.name(), &device).second;
  }

  auto unregister_device(device &) -> bool
  {
    kstd::println("[OS:DEV] TODO: implement device deregistration");
    return false;
  }

  auto find_device(std::string_view name) -> kstd::observer_ptr<device>
  {
    for (auto const & [key, value] : device_tree)
    {
      if (value->name() == name)
      {
        return value;
      }
    }
    return nullptr;
  }

}  // namespace kapi::devices

namespace kapi::test_support::devices
{
  auto deinit() -> void
  {
    deinit_interface_registry();

    kapi::devices::root_bus.reset();
  }
}  // namespace kapi::test_support::devices
